#7064c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7064c2 is composed of 43.9% red, 39.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 247.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 57.6%. #7064c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0c8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7064c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7064c2 has RGB values of R:112, G:100,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7365826.

Shades and Tints of #7064c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7064c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8e98 is the less saturated color, while #452afc is the most saturated one.
